Argenta council luncheon nears

Hugh Forrest, chief programming officer for South by Southwest of Austin, Texas, is to be the keynote speaker at the Argenta Downtown Council's annual luncheon at 11:30 a.m. June 5 in the Wyndham Riverfront Hotel in North Little Rock.

The luncheon is the major fundraiser for the Argenta Downtown Council, a nonprofit that promotes the Argenta Arts District in North Little Rock's downtown. Tickets are $125, with proceeds to benefit the downtown council's efforts to improve and market the Argenta Arts District.

Tickets can be obtained by emailing ckent@argentadc.org. More information on the organization is available at argentaartsdistrict.org.

Forrest joined South by Southwest (SXSW) in 1989 after serving on the National Advisory Board for the Poynter Institute in St. Petersburg, Fla. He is a member of the board of directors for Austin Habitat for Humanity and the Austin-based accessibility company, Knowability.

South by Southwest is a series of interactive film and music festivals and conferences in Austin. The SXSW Festival in Austin began in 1987. Its conference last year attracted 75,098 people, according to a news release about the June 5 luncheon.

Hubble telescope exhibit to kick off

NASA's "New Views of the Universe: Hubble Space Telescope" exhibit will be on display May 31-Aug. 31 in the second-floor gallery of the William F. Laman Public Library at 2801 Orange St.

An opening reception will be 6-8 p.m. May 31. Project engineer Maurice Henderson will talk about his work with NASA's support of the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ration's Science on a Sphere room-sized visualization platform and the interactive Hubble Space Telescope exhibit.

The exhibit will kick off the library system's University of Stories Summer Reading Program events. The University of Stories program, consisting of books, DVDs and audiobooks, will run through Aug. 3. Program information can be obtained using the Summer Reading tab at lamanlibrary.org.

Programs' funding focus of hearing

A public hearing is scheduled for June 10 in the City Council Chambers in the North Little Rock City Hall, at 300 Main St., during the 6 p.m City Council meeting. The council will consider approving the proposed annual action plan for the 2019 Community Development Block Grant and the 2019 Home Investments Partnerships program funding.

A 30-day comment period began May 12 and will end June 10, which is the deadline to receive all comments.

Copies of the plan are available for public review at City Hall and at the Community Development Agency, at 500 W. 13th St., in North Little Rock. The plan is also online on the city's website at nlr.ar.gov/communitydevelopment.

The public comment period and public hearing are to allow comments from city residents on the strategies and priorities outlined in the plan in addressing the needs of low- and moderate-income households and neighborhoods.
